Preview trailer for the Supergirl midseason premiere "Legion of Super-Heroes"
Preview clip and "Inside" video promoting the Supergirl episode "Reign"
Screen captures from the preview trailer for the Supergirl midseason finale "Reign"
Official preview images for the Supergirl season finale titled "Reign"
CW preview trailer for the Supergirl episode "Reign"
Supergirl's Melissa Benoist talks about this year's DC TV crossover "Crisis on Earth-X."
Supergirl cast member Chyler Leigh previews the four-show DC TV crossover "Crisis on Earth-X" airing on The CW.
Preview clip for the Supergirl episode "Wake Up"
Actor David Harewood has shared a peek inside the Legion ship on Supergirl.
Preview images for the Supergirl chapter of the DC TV crossover "Crisis on Earth-X, Part 1"